Congenic animals are those that are genetically identical except for one or a few specific genes, making them ideal for research and experimental studies. However, animals that are not congenic may differ significantly in their genetic makeup, making them less suitable for controlled studies. These animals may be randomly bred, have varying genetic backgrounds or may be derived from different strains. The variability among genetically different animals can create challenges in interpreting research data and results.
